Description
Scope of Work Review DGE's existing "TranslationHub" inventory (user type, feature, category, description) and the comprehensive Figma user-journey document, and use them as the source material for course scoping. Break down features and processes into course modules, grouped by workflow ("flow") and by persona, using logical/module-based grouping rather than a strict feature-by-feature structure. Design and build storyboards for each course (in Figma or PowerPoint, per DGE's internal decision). Develop each course as an interactive Articulate course, including: An introduction/welcome segment A conversational Q&A segment that sets the baseline objective A guided, step-by-step process simulation A graded assessment Write the two-person conversational scripts used for each course's intro/Q&A segment for AI voiceover generation. Build guided, click-through process simulations that mimic the live TranslationHub platform screens end to end. Write MCQ-based question banks for each course's assessment. Package finished courses as SCORM-compliant files and hand them over to the CDP platform team for upload. The freelancer/DGE side will not have production upload access. Coordinate with Hashem Adnan Jadan on Arabic localization, terminology alignment, and course QA sign-off. Participate in recurring weekly syncs with the CDP platform team, as well as a technical kickoff/recap call early in the engagement. Required Skills & ToolsMandatory Proven, hands-on experience with Articulate (Storyline or equivalent). This is the client's licensed, standard authoring tool, so candidates must already have experience using it. Experience packaging and delivering SCORM-compliant e-learning courses. Instructional design experience for enterprise, process, or system training, particularly software walkthroughs and role-based workflows rather than general knowledge courses. Comfortable designing from a Figma or PowerPoint storyboard and building guided platform simulations (click-through, step-by-step process walkthroughs). Experience designing course assessments, including MCQ question banks, pass thresholds, and section-based question pools. Preferred / Nice to Have Experience with AI voiceover tools (the client's platform team uses ElevenLabs) and writing conversational, two-presenter scripts for voiceover generation. Arabic-language e-learning localization experience, particularly Modern Standard/official Arabic rather than colloquial dialects. Prior experience building courses for a government or public-sector ERP/HR platform, or a similar large-scale enterprise rollout.
